    [POWERPC] Simplify error logic in rtas_setup_msi_irqs() · fcbe8090
    Michael Ellerman authored Sep 20, 2007
    
    
    rtas_setup_msi_irqs() doesn't need to call teardown() itself, the
    generic code will do this for us as long as we return a non-zero
    value.
